Houston County deputy fired after child sex crime arrest
HOUSTON COUNTY, Texas (KETK) — The Houston County Sheriff’s Office has fired one of their own after learning former Deputy Skyler Laza was arrested on child sex crime charges.
At around 5 p.m. on Wednesday, Houston County Sheriff Zak Benge was contacted by the Texas Department of Public Safety’s Criminal Investigation Division regarding an employee who was the subject of an investigation.
About an hour later, Sheriff Benge was informed that Laza had been arrested at his home in Palestine and charged with aggravated sexual assault of a child.
The sheriff traveled to the Anderson County Jail, where Laza was being held and terminated his employment effective immediately.
The allegations and supporting evidence against Laza are truly disturbing. It is sickening to me that a person who sought a position meant to help those in our community, especially the most vulnerable, our children, would be the very person arrested for abuse. My office will continue to work with the investigating agencies and assist in every way possible to ensure that Laza, and anyone else involved in these heinous acts of abuse against this juvenile victim, are punished to the fullest extent of the law.
Sheriff Zak Benge
